Android Backup on Google Server for Evo?
 
i have seen in a couple of custom Roms (and nexus one) a backup service called Google Backup which stores your wifi, apps settings, etc. to google's server. it ususally shows up in the initial setup of an ASOP based rom...

I wonder why is it not on our EVOs? and how to get it?


i have searched, but nothing comes up in google about it...
in ASOP rom is under settings->privacy, but that does not exists on my evo (using rooted stock rom right now)...
anyone have an answer to this?

MrDSL 08-02-2010 02:26 PM

Re: Android Backup on Google Server for Evo?
 
Its an option in Android 2.2 but not 2.1..I honestly can't remember if it was in the 2.2 sense rom that was leaked but if its not then HTC must of taken it out.

What you are looking for is the Cyanogen ROM. Everything in it was built from the ground up using just the Open Source code directly from Google. The apps and settings backup does work on it along with the built-in wifi and usb tether. What does not work is 4G, HDMI, and FM radio. I anticipate HDMI being included very soon, but 4G is what is holding most people back. There are nightly builds with changes being posted every day. It is awesome as long as you are ok with no 4G.

http://buildbot.teamdouche.net/nightly/supersonic/

edit: The backup doesn't actually backup the data associated with your apps. So, you will have to reset them each time you factory reset or wipe and flash. Things like login settings or high scores will not be saved. The other things backed up are things like your ringtone, wallpaper, wifi networks.
